The grand alliance that was united during the Karnataka chief minister's swearing-in ceremony for the 2019Lok Sabha pollsseems to already undergo conflict as the Samajawadi Party has decided not to ally with Congress in Uttar Pradesh for 2019 Lok Sabha.

Several media reports have quoted SP sources as saying that they were not willing to ally with the Congress in UP.

The sources claim that the Congress "does not fit into the political narrative"that the SP and Bahujan Samaj Party want to build against the BJP in UP.

Though the party will not collaborate with the Congress in 2019 Lok Sabha elections, SP has decided not to field any candidate in Congress bastion Raibareli and Amethi headed by UPA chairperson Sonia Gandhi and Congress president Rahul Gandhi respectively.

The sources said that the SP was not willing to ally with the Congress as it lost the 2017 assembly polls fought in an alliance with the party.

The SP has however confirmed that their alliance with BSamaj Samaja Party (BSP) and the Rashtriya Lok Dal (RLD) was intact.
